Indian Army officer dies of cardiac arrest in Leh
Leh, March 07 (KMS): In Indian illegally occupied Jammu and Kashmir, an Indian Army officer died after suffering from heart attack in Leh area of Ladakh region.
Col R.S. Kadwasara, who was serving in station headquarters Leh, died of cardiac arrest. He hailed from Pilani city in Jhunjhunu district of the Indian state of Rajasthan.
It to mention here that cardiac arrests have become very common among the Indian soldiers as this is the third such death in the last few days.
A constable of Indian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) died of the heart attack while running during training at Lethpora in outskirts of Srinagar, yesterday (Monday). Earlier, a colonel ranked Indian Army officer had died of cardiac arrest in north Kashmir’s Baramulla district on Sunday.
